Tata Memorial Hospital in Mumbai was subject to a bomb threat hoax, as revealed by the city police on Friday. The hospital received an alarming email, sparking immediate concern. Acting swiftly, the Mumbai Police conducted an exhaustive search of the premises to ensure the safety of all individuals present.

According to a police official, the information regarding the threat was directly relayed by the hospital. Despite initial fears, the subsequent investigation concluded without any discovery of hazardous materials or devices on-site.

The police confirmed that the email threat was unfounded. Assuring that all security protocols were followed, authorities declared the area safe and urged the public to remain calm and vigilant.
